But yes, as Peanut has said, No chatspeak, the 2:1 policy, and rating works are a must to know. It also helps to know the color legend here on YWS.

"Once upon a time in the far, far away lands of YWS, a king and his kingd--"

:P Oops. I mean. Colors. Right?

Red = Admins; There are currently three Admins on YWS. They are the creator of YWS, and two junior admins. Together, the three of them take care of the underworld of YWS, making sure the foundations are steady and the gears can turn smoothly.

Dark Green = Moderators; While the Admins are busy underground, someone has to keep their eye on the main level! The moderators are like the police; they keep everything under control here. If you ever have a problem, or see something wrong, report to them!

Light green = junior moderators. Mods are so busy taking care of the vast, vast,vast lands of YWS, that we have junior moderators who focus on certain areas of the site. Junior Moderators are moderators, so if you have a problem, you can report to them as well.

Orange = Distinguished members. These people have served YWS well for a long, long time. Time came for them to retire from moderator-dome and take a rest. Otherwise, they might have... we won't go there. ;)


Purple = Instructors. I'm sure you know that one of the main parts of YWS is reviewing. :D Instructors love reviewing and critiquing literature. They're also known to be grammar freaks, or something like that, and obsess over the little parts of punctuation and stuff.

But, you're welcome to bug us for reviews anytime. ;)


Blue = greeter. These people welcome new comers to the website. It seems like, "hey, how hard can that be?"

It's hard! Try smiling sincerely and repeating rules every day for a long, long time. :) But, they love their job. :D


- - * --
A review must be 250 characters to count as a review :D.


And! We have a star system that indicates the amount of reviews you have completed:

Yellow/Gold

5 Reviews = 1 Star
25 Reviews = 2 Stars
75 Reviews = 3 Stars
150 Reviews = 4 Stars
250 Reviews = 5 Stars


Blue Stars:


350 Reviews = 1 Blue Star, 4 Gold Stars
450 Reviews = 2 Blue Stars, 3 Gold Stars
550 Reviews = 3 Blue Stars, 2 Gold Stars
650 Reviews = 4 blue stars, 1 Gold star
750 Reviews = 5 blue stars

Red Stars:

850 Reviews = 1 Red Star, 4 Blue Stars
950 Reviews = 2 Red Stars, 3 Blue Stars
1,050 Reviews = 3 Red stars, 2 Blue Stars
1,150 Reviews = 4 Red stars, 1 Blue star
1,250 Reviews = 5 Red stars


There's also the points system: You need 150 points to post a new story, but you get up to (depending on the length of your piece) 50 points back. Therefore, you're only losing 100 points, but you need the 50 extra.


And! Points also determine the next featured member. The person with the most points, and has outstanding performance in the welcome/literary forums is chosen as the featured member. :D
